Early Life and Background

Charley Webb was born Charlotte Anne Webb on 26 February 1988 in Bury, Greater Manchester, England. She grew up in the North West and developed an early interest in performance and drama during her school years. Raised in a close-knit family, she has spoken publicly about the support she received while pursuing acting as a teenager.

Before joining mainstream television, Charley Webb appeared in smaller roles, including parts in British drama series. Her northern upbringing influenced her natural on-screen presence, particularly when she later portrayed working-class characters. From a young age, she demonstrated confidence in front of the camera, which helped her transition smoothly into long-term television work.

Breakthrough in Emmerdale

Charley Webb is most widely recognised for her portrayal of Debbie Dingle in Emmerdale. She joined the cast in 2002 at just 14 years old, stepping into a character who would become central to the Dingle family storyline.

Debbie Dingle quickly evolved from a troubled teenager into one of the soap’s most complex characters. Over the years, Charley Webb’s performances covered themes such as teen pregnancy, crime, family breakdown, and romantic drama. Her ability to portray vulnerability and resilience made Debbie one of the programme’s most talked-about figures.

Charley Webb remained a regular cast member for nearly 19 years, with short breaks in between. Her final exit from Emmerdale came in 2021, marking the end of a significant chapter in her career.

Debbie Dingle’s Key Storylines

One of Debbie’s earliest major plots involved becoming pregnant as a teenager. This storyline addressed real-life social issues and contributed to strong viewer engagement. Charley Webb’s portrayal was widely praised for its realism and emotional depth.

Another significant arc involved Debbie’s involvement in criminal activity and complex romantic relationships. Over time, Debbie became a businesswoman within the show, running garages and navigating family tensions. These storylines allowed Charley Webb to showcase a wide acting range, from dramatic confrontations to tender family moments.

Relationship with Matthew Wolfenden

Charley Webb met actor Matthew Wolfenden on the set of Emmerdale. He played David Metcalfe in the same series, and their on-screen workplace turned into a real-life romance.

The couple married in February 2018 after several years together. Their relationship attracted media interest because both were established soap actors. They often shared glimpses of family life on social media, presenting a relatable and down-to-earth image.

In 2023, reports confirmed that Charley Webb and Matthew Wolfenden had separated. The announcement generated significant public attention, though both remained focused on co-parenting their children.

Family Life and Children

Charley Webb is a mother of three sons. Her first child was born in 2010, followed by two more in 2015 and 2019. Throughout her Emmerdale career, she balanced filming schedules with maternity leave and parenting responsibilities.

She has spoken openly about the challenges of juggling work and family life. Fans appreciated her candid posts about motherhood, which often highlighted everyday realities rather than glamourised portrayals.

Her experience as a parent influenced some of her career decisions, including stepping back from full-time acting. Family remains a central part of Charley Webb’s public identity.

Life After Emmerdale

Charley Webb officially stepped away from Emmerdale in 2021. While she has not announced a permanent retirement from acting, she has prioritised family and business projects since leaving.

There has been ongoing speculation among fans about whether she might return to the soap. ITV soaps often leave the door open for character comebacks, and Debbie Dingle remains a popular figure. However, as of 2025, there is no confirmed return date.

In interviews, Charley Webb has indicated that she remains open to new creative opportunities, provided they fit with her lifestyle and family commitments.
